Jim Louvau: I know
before the Juggernaut
records came out, the
story and plot were
pretty hush hush, but
now that they are out,
can you tell us a little
more about both?
Spencer Sotelo: I don’t
like to get super in-depth
about the story in interviews
because I look at it like a
movie. When you see a trailer,
you don’t really know what
the movie is about and if you
knew everything the movie
was going to be about and you
knew how it was going to play
out, you wouldn’t really want to go
see it because you know everything about it already. The story is
basically about this guy who is born
into a sadistic cult. The story plays
out his whole life and going back and
forth between good and bad and him
wanting to live a normal life.
Jim Louvau: How did the story develop?
Spencer Sotelo: Last year, when we were
working on the records as a band, I was
doing a lot of movie watching and a lot of
gaming. A lot of the movies and shows I
was watching were horror style and based
on the occult and things like that. Rosemary’s
Baby has always been one of my favorite
horror movies and at the time, I was watching a show called True Detective. That greatly
inspired me when writing the story for the first
record.
